05/12/2006: "ST. FLORIAN MARCH & MASS PICS"

We'd like to thank everyone for showing up at our annual St. Florian Firefighter March and Mass. Firefighters from all over the Metro Detroit showed up including Detroit, Frenchtown, Eastpointe, as well as the Honor Guard and Bagpipers.

Thanks again to all those that showed up and Fr. Thomas and St. Florian for once again having us.
